Microgrids, battery storage projects get funding

DTE Energy in Michigan got awarded US$22.7 million to create a network of "adaptive" microgrids that would include 12MWh of battery storage and 500kW of solar generation. DTE''s microgrids could reduce outages for customers within those areas by 50% to 80% and reduce the runtime of diesel generators by 294 hours, or 5% per year.

FortisTCI boosts power generation capacity amidst soaring energy

This year, a 1.2-megawatt solar plus battery microgrid will be commissioned in North Caicos, poised to supply 30% of the Twin Islands'' energy demand. Additionally, groundwork is underway for a 200-kWdc solar plus battery microgrid on Salt Cay, projected to fulfil 91% of the island''s energy needs upon completion in 2025.

Hybrid power coming for Twin Islands and Salt Cay -FortisTCI

To propel the TCI into an era of clean energy, FortisTCI will invest $8m to install the country''s first solar plus battery microgrids to power 30% of the electricity supply on North and Middle Caicos and 91% of the electricity supply on Salt Cay in 2024.

FortisTCI announces $8 million investment in TCI''s First Solar plus

Providenciales, Turks and Caicos Islands (Thursday, June 8, 2023) – FortisTCI will invest $8 million to install the country''s first solar plus battery microgrids to power 30% of the electricity supply on North and Middle Caicos and 91% of the electricity supply on Salt Cay in 2024. The microgrids represent the Company''s single largest green energy investment to date.
